LRC Maker5分钟掌握专业歌词制作的免费开源工具【免费下载链接】lrc-maker歌词滚动姬可能是你所能见到的最好用的歌词制作工具项目地址: https://gitcode.com/gh_mirrors/lr/lrc-maker在数字音乐时代精准的歌词同步能极大提升听觉体验但传统歌词制作工具往往需要复杂的软件安装和技术知识。LRC Maker作为一款免费开源的歌词制作工具彻底改变了这一现状。这款创新的在线工具让普通用户也能轻松制作专业级的滚动歌词文件无需安装任何软件直接在浏览器中运行。无论你是音乐爱好者、语言学习者还是内容创作者都能在几分钟内掌握这项技能为任何音频文件添加完美同步的时间标签。 为什么LRC Maker成为歌词制作的首选工具传统歌词制作的痛点与解决方案传统歌词制作面临三大难题软件复杂难上手、跨平台兼容性差、时间同步不精准。LRC Maker针对这些问题提供了革命性的解决方案零学习曲线设计- 界面简洁直观用户只需专注于歌词内容本身纯Web技术实现- 在任何现代浏览器中都能完美运行智能时间标记系统- 按空格键即可精准记录时间点核心技术架构现代前端技术的完美融合LRC Maker基于React TypeScript Vite的现代前端技术栈构建确保了极致的性能和用户体验。项目采用模块化设计核心功能集中在src/components/目录下editor.tsx歌词编辑器组件支持实时编辑和时间标记audio.tsx音频播放控制组件提供精准的播放控制waveform.tsx波形可视化组件直观显示音频结构synchronizer.tsx时间同步引擎确保歌词与音频完美匹配音频处理的核心逻辑位于src/utils/audiomodule.ts这个模块负责音频加载、播放控制和波形分析等关键功能。工具使用了wavesurfer.js库来实现高质量的音频可视化让用户能够直观看到音乐的高低起伏。 快速上手从零开始制作第一份LRC歌词第一步环境准备与项目部署LRC Maker提供多种使用方式满足不同用户的需求在线使用推荐新手直接访问官方网站在线使用无需任何安装配置。本地部署适合开发者git clone https://gitcode.com/gh_mirrors/lr/lrc-maker cd lrc-maker npm install npm startDocker部署适合生产环境docker build -t lrc-maker . docker run -d -p 8080:80 lrc-maker第二步音频导入与波形分析工具支持多种音频导入方式点击加载音频按钮选择本地文件直接将音频文件拖拽到波形显示区域支持MP3、WAV、FLAC等常见音频格式导入后系统会自动解析音频波形为后续歌词同步提供视觉参考。波形图不仅能帮助用户直观看到音乐节奏变化还能精确标记歌词开始和结束的时间点。第三步歌词编辑与时间同步在右侧的编辑区域输入歌词文本每行一句。播放音频时当听到某句歌词开始时只需按下空格键工具就会自动记录当前时间点。这个过程就像为歌词打拍子一样自然流畅。⚡ 高效制作技巧专业用户的秘密武器快捷键魔法速度提升300%掌握LRC Maker的快捷键组合能极大提升制作效率快捷键组合功能描述空格键插入时间标签核心功能CtrlEnter播放/暂停音频方向键↑↓在歌词行间快速导航/-键微调当前行时间标签Ctrl↑/↓调整播放速度适合不同语速的歌曲批量操作与高级功能当需要整体调整歌词时间时可以使用批量偏移功能。在同步器面板中找到时间偏移控制输入正负值即可一次性调整所有时间标签这对于修复整体时间偏差特别有用。工具还提供以下高级功能多语言支持内置9种语言界面中文、英文、日文、韩文等歌词信息编辑可设置歌曲标题、歌手、专辑等元数据导出格式多样支持标准LRC格式导出兼容所有主流播放器 技术特点与创新设计现代前端技术栈的优势LRC Maker采用的技术栈带来了显著优势性能优化使用Vite构建工具实现快速的热更新和构建类型安全TypeScript确保代码质量和开发效率组件化设计React组件化架构便于维护和扩展跨平台兼容性设计工具采用纯Web技术开发这意味着你可以在任何设备上使用它桌面浏览器Chrome、Firefox、Edge、Safari等现代浏览器移动设备通过手机浏览器也能正常使用离线使用支持PWA技术安装后可在离线环境下使用音频处理核心技术src/utils/audiomodule.ts模块是工具的核心它实现了音频文件的加载与解码精确的时间控制毫秒级精度波形数据的实时分析播放状态的同步管理 实际应用场景与价值音乐爱好者的个性化体验为个人收藏的音乐创建精准歌词在支持LRC格式的播放器中享受完美同步的歌词显示效果。无论是制作卡拉OK伴奏还是创建个人歌单LRC Maker都能提供专业级的支持。教育领域的创新应用语言教师可以利用LRC Maker制作带时间标记的外语歌词帮助学生通过音乐学习语言。研究表明通过歌曲学习语言能提高记忆效率而精确的时间同步让学习体验更加流畅。内容创作者的辅助工具视频创作者可以使用LRC Maker制作字幕文件通过简单转换即可应用到视频编辑软件中。相比传统字幕制作工具LRC Maker的时间精度更高操作更简单。 项目架构与代码组织清晰的目录结构LRC Maker的项目结构设计得非常清晰便于开发者理解和贡献代码lrc-maker/ ├── src/ │ ├── components/ # 所有React组件 │ ├── const/ # 常量配置 │ ├── hooks/ # 自定义React Hooks │ ├── languages/ # 多语言文件 │ ├── polyfill/ # 浏览器兼容性处理 │ └── utils/ # 工具函数和核心逻辑 ├── public/ # 静态资源 ├── worker/ # Web Worker脚本 └── types/ # TypeScript类型定义核心模块解析音频处理模块(audiomodule.ts)音频加载与播放控制时间同步管理波形数据解析歌词解析模块(useLrc.ts)LRC格式解析与生成时间标签处理歌词文本操作用户界面组件(components/)响应式设计适配不同设备无障碍访问支持多语言界面切换 持续开发与社区贡献开源生态与社区支持LRC Maker作为开源项目拥有活跃的开发社区。项目采用MIT许可证任何人都可以自由使用、修改和分发。如果你对项目有改进建议或发现了bug可以通过GitHub Issues提交反馈。现代化开发流程项目的开发流程非常规范 RR自动化构建通过GitHub Actions实现持续集成代码质量检查使用TypeScript确保类型安全格式化规范dprint工具统一代码风格性能优化策略LRC Maker在性能优化方面做了大量工作按需加载只加载当前需要的语言包和组件虚拟滚动处理大量歌词行时依然保持流畅Web Worker音频处理在后台线程进行不阻塞UI缓存策略合理利用浏览器缓存提升加载速度 立即开始你的歌词制作之旅LRC Maker以其免费开源、功能强大、易于使用的特点正在重新定义歌词制作的行业标准。无论你是想为心爱的歌曲制作歌词还是需要为教学材料添加时间标记这款工具都能满足你的需求。开始使用LRC Maker的三种方式在线使用直接访问官方网站在线使用本地部署克隆仓库后在本地运行Docker部署使用提供的Dockerfile快速部署到服务器记住制作完美歌词的关键不是技术而是对音乐的理解和热爱。LRC Maker只是为你提供了一个表达这种热爱的工具。现在就开始你的歌词创作之旅吧让每一句歌词都能与旋律完美共鸣下一步行动建议立即体验访问在线版本尝试制作第一份歌词深入学习查看项目源码了解实现原理参与贡献提交issue或pull request帮助改进工具分享成果将制作的歌词分享给朋友传播音乐之美LRC Maker不仅是一个工具更是一个连接音乐与技术的桥梁。在这个数字化的时代让我们用技术让音乐更加动人让歌词更加精准让每一次聆听都成为完美的体验。【免费下载链接】lrc-maker歌词滚动姬可能是你所能见到的最好用的歌词制作工具项目地址: https://gitcode.com/gh_mirrors/lr/lrc-maker创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考